Under the surface of New Zealand is something completely special! The following pictures will prove to you that this country is as beautiful underground, as on its surface. The Waitomo region is famous for its limestone caves, in which the most magical insects in the world live - fireflies. These tiny creatures emit a phosphorescent glow, which makes the cave a truly surreal place.

Briton Sean Jeffers, specializing in travel photography, was completely subdued by the beauty of these places and took a lot of amazing shots here. Here are the most impressive of them.
